Output 2d146a3b602af4ced44d297e326ec95ea3b0bb7580f3192a0800d4534ee5ce71:2

value
2499388
script pubkey
OP_HASH160 OP_PUSHBYTES_20 424f29a8a84fa867814ff9ded43379c9dc9a6814 OP_EQUAL
address
37jdMXYbvg3dKzJ4pGSYiABiXoBy4putZq
transaction
2d146a3b602af4ced44d297e326ec95ea3b0bb7580f3192a0800d4534ee5ce71
confirmations
20969
spent
true